Ode To Deodorant value?

Featured Replies

Does anyone know how much is an original unplayed cassette of Ode To Deodorant is worth? I've seen the price of Safety EP shoot up and I imagine this cassette is more of a rarity?

it's difficult to say. when Record Collector released their collective list of CP rarities and associated values, the Safety EP was listed at a higher value mark than Ode, but I've come across a handful of opportunities to purchase the Safety EP, and only one or two for Ode. Unsure how/why they associated those values to the items, but in either case, I'd assume the final mark will be between $1200-$2000 USD. It would have been a brighter idea for the seller to post the item after the release of the next record, when fenceline collectors have their eyes on the band again.

Honestly, I think anyone can make a tape and sell it...because the song has been out. All you would have to do is buy a tape, copy the design and record it. How would you be able to tell if it's an original one?

that's where you need to know your merchandise; looks legit to me, not only with the business card info, but the look of the cassette as compared to the few i've seen, but you'd be smart to research the item, learn its specifics and ask questions.

 

looks like he's not going to accept anything lower than 1000 GBP.

It definitely looks like the real thing. I have one (bought on ebay in 2005) and this one looks exactly like it. As far as I can tell, this is only the second time that an original 'printed label' cassette comes up for sale on ebay.

 

There was also a 2nd original version with a 'handwritten label' on ebay about 3 years ago which is recorded on exactly the same cassette brand.
